Commack, NY Hunt Corporate Services, Inc. has completed the sale of a 9,500 s/f suburban office building at 354 Veterans Memorial Hwy. for $1.125 million. An investor bought the building, which has a healthy tenant mix of attorneys, accountants, physicians, and non-profits. The three-story building is part of an office park at the entrance to the Northern State Pkwy. that was originally built in the 1980s by developer Herman Udasin.
